Summary

There is a security vulnerability in IBM WebSphere Application Server that is shipped with IBM Cloud Orchestrator and IBM Cloud Orchestrator Enterprise Edition.

IBM Cloud Orchestrator and WebSphere Application Server have addressed this vulnerability.

Vulnerability Details

CVEID: CVE-2017-1382
DESCRIPTION:
IBM WebSphere Application Server might create files using the default permissions instead of the customized permissions when custom startup scripts are used. A local attacker could exploit this to gain access to files with an unknown impact.
CVSS Base Score: 5.1
CVSS Temporal Score: See https://exchange.xforce.ibmcloud.com/vulnerabilities/127153 for the current score
CVSS Environmental Score*: Undefined
C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.0/A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:N)

Affected Products and Versions

Principal Product and Version(s)

Affected Supporting Product and Version
IBM Cloud Orchestrator and Cloud Orchestrator Enterprise V2.5, V2.5.0.1, V2.5.0.2, V2.5.0.3IBM WebSphere Application Server V8.5.5 to 8.5.5.11
IBM Cloud Orchestrator and Cloud Orchestrator Enterprise V2.4, V2.4.0.1, V2.4.0.2, V2.4.0.3IBM WebSphere Application Server V8.5.5 to 8.5.5.12
IBM Cloud Orchestrator and Cloud Orchestrator Enterprise V2.3, V2.3.0.1IBM WebSphere Application Server V8.0.0.1 to V8.0.0.11

Remediation/Fixes

This issue has been addressed by IBM Cloud Orchestrator (Standard and Enterprise Edition) and through IBM WebSphere Application Server that is shipped with IBM Cloud Orchestrator and IBM Cloud Orchestrator Enterprise Edition.

Fix delivery details for IBM Cloud Orchestrator:

ProductVRMFRemediation/First Fix
IBM Cloud Orchestrator and IBM Cloud Orchestrator EnterpriseV2.5, V2.5.0.1 IFix1, V2.5.0.2, V2.5.0.3For 2.5 versions, upgrade to Fix Pack 4 (2.5.0.4) of IBM Cloud Orchestrator.
http://www-01.ibm.com/support/docview.wss?uid=swg2C4000062
After you upgrade, apply the appropriate Interim to your environment as soon as practical. For details, see Security Bulletin: WebSphere Application Server may have insecure file permissions (CVE-2017-1382).
IBM Cloud Orchestrator and IBM Cloud Orchestrator EnterpriseV2.4, V2.4.0.1, V2.4.0.2, V2.4.0.3, V2.4.0.4For 2.4 versions, IBM recommends upgrading to Fix Pack 5 (2.4.0.5) of IBM Cloud Orchestrator.
http://www-01.ibm.com/support/docview.wss?uid=swg2C4000063
IBM Cloud Orchestrator and IBM Cloud Orchestrator Enterprise V2.3, V2.3.0.1Notice product withdrawal announcement as per ENUS917-138
